Mark McNally

Mark McNally joined Land Rover in 1989 spending his early career delivering new vehicle programmes and model year projects at the Solihull Manufacturing Plant. Throughout his extensive 35year career he has held several senior management positions in Product Engineering, Programme Management, Manufacturing Operations & Engineering Research, both in the UK and abroad. Since 2010, Mark has led a portfolio of future mobility R&D projects, underpinning the next generation of advanced electrification propulsion systems in partnership with Innovate UK, academia, SMEs, and supply chain, most notable one of the UKs largest Government funded automotive research programme ‘Evoque-e’ in 2015, delivering the technical foundation for the new Jaguar iPace EV.

In 2017, Mark was appointed Head of Global Manufacturing Innovation within Jaguar Land Rover’s Manufacturing Group, accountable for the overall manufacturing innovation strategy and building cross sector collaborations to inform technology roadmaps in: future factories, human centric manufacturing, smart connect enterprise, immersive capabilities.

In May 2019, Mark was appointed Interim Challenge Director at UK Research & Innovation leading the Manufacturing Made Smarter Industrial Strategy Challenge Fund strategic planning, business case and delivery plan. Following the successful delivery and transition to the operational team, Mark established RAVMAC Ltd consultancy working with businesses and organisations driving operational and organisational capabilities through the application of digital technology strategies and technical road mapping.
